



Overview
The Mercury+ XU8 system-on-chip (SoC) module combines Xilinx's Zynq UltraScale+™ MPSoC-series device with fast DDR4 ECC SDRAM, eMMC flash, quad SPI flash, dual Gigabit Ethernet PHY, dual USB 3.0 and thus forms a complete and powerful embedded processing system.
Highlights
Built around Xilinx's Zynq Ultrascale+™ MPSoC
Two independent memory channels for PS (DDR4 ECC SDRAM) and PL (DDR4 SDRAM)
Up to 28.8 GByte/sec memory bandwidth
Offers PCIe® Gen3 x16, PCIe Gen2 x4, 2x USB 3.0 and 2x Gigabit Ethernet interfaces
Available in industrial temperature range
Three 168-pin Hirose FX10 connectors with 236 user I/Os
Benefits
A complete and powerful embedded processing system in a compact, space-saving form factor
Large, high-bandwidth memory, with up to 8 GByte of DDR4 ECC SDRAM (PS) and up to 4 GByte of DDR4 RAM (PL)
High-bandwidth data transfer: PCIe® Gen3 x16, PCIe Gen2 x4, USB 3.0, and a high number of available LVDS pairs provide high-speed data I/O at low integration cost
Lowest power consumption due to the high-efficiency DC/DC converters
Support for Linux embedded operating system
Features
ARM®quad-core Cortex™-A53 (CG models: dual-core)
ARM dual-core Cortex™-R5
Mali-400MP2 GPU (only for EV models)
H.264 / H.265 Video Codec (only for EV models)
16nm FinFET+ FPGA fabric
Up to 8 GB DDR4 ECC SDRAM (PS)
Up to 4 GB DDR4 SDRAM (PL)
64 MB QSPI flash
16 GB eMMC flash
PCIe® Gen3 ×16 and PCIe Gen2 ×4
20 × 6/12.5/15 Gbit/sec MGT
2 × Gigabit Ethernet
2 × USB 3.0
2 × USB 2.0 (host & host/device)
Up to 504,000 LUT4-eq
14 ARM peripherals
122 FPGA I/Os
100 MGT signals (clock and data)
5 to 15 V single supply
Small form factor (74 × 54 mm)
